I have a backup that is stuck on the last 1% of syncing. I have paused and restarted the sync, restarted my computer, cleared the dropbox cache, and cant figure out why it wont finish.  Dropbox support is telling me it's because certain filenames are formatted incorrectly so those files affected won't sync.  Problem is, I can't rename these files because they are all referenced by Pro Tools.  If I went through and renamed the affected files, this would make the backup completely useless to me in the first place.  The drive is formatted to Mac OS Extended (Journaled).  To make matters worse, the Dropbox desktop app for Mac does NOT tell you which files are the culprits, so you are left just watching an endless sync that goes nowhere.  

You would think in 2023 simply making a cloud backup of one of your external drives would be straightforward.  I wish Dropbox wouldn't make the claim that they are a service that can effectively do it.  I wasted an entire night and half of a work day trying to get this up and running.  Any suggestions/help would be greatly appreciated
